WSJ: U.S. Embassy in Afghanistan Orders Nonessential Staff to Leave Country
By Jessica Donati
April 27, 2021 6:27 pm ET
The U.S. has ordered withdrawals from its embassy in Afghanistan as a May 1 deadline for troop withdrawal arrives. President Biden has announced a new withdrawal date of Sept. 11, 2021.
